Bee keeping photograph project.

Hi my name is Mike.I am starting a project photographing bee keepers and bees themselves.The project is about the mutual respect between the keeper and the bee, showing the beauty of the collection of honey and the care you put in collecting it. This is partly an issue-based project, due to the worldwide problems Apiarist are facing with the loss of Honey Bee Colonies, mainly associated with environment and climate factors, leading to the colony collapse disorder (CCD).
